Designing Immersive Media That Feels Real Without More Visual Detail

When people describe an immersive experience as “real,” they rarely mean every texture looked like a photograph. More often, they mean they instinctively reached for something, reacted when someone entered their personal space, or briefly forgot they were wearing a headset.
